Output 99586c821a42f31675499c61a802aa74264d27c838d7545326ba80a08db1ae5c:11

value
18349
script pubkey
OP_0 OP_PUSHBYTES_20 190c362b5ff1bc24005961144dc17591605985c5
address
bc1qryxrv26l7x7zgqzevy2ymst4j9s9npw92k8ut6
transaction
99586c821a42f31675499c61a802aa74264d27c838d7545326ba80a08db1ae5c
spent
true